Strategic Paper
30 years in, and the electronic revolution that would bring about the end of scribing on dead timber seems to be perpetually another three decades away, if it even still exists as a goal for...
30 years in, and the electronic revolution that would bring about the end of scribing on dead timber seems to be perpetually another three decades away, if it even still exists as a goal for...
Lists of accomplishments at work are a useful exercise, both for performance reviews in the moment, but also for posterity[1] years after the fact. Through a variety of employers, roles, and even note-taking apps,...
Once in a while—inspired by company intranets and wiki pages—I get the thought in my head that the same level of organization should be applied to my life overall. With most the information...
I'm a personal finance geek. Starting with Mint and their budgeting tools and having moved on to Personal Capital for their investment tracking, I appreciate understanding where my money is coming and going,...
Solving communication with clever tooling is akin to buying into a get-rich-quick scheme. I’d like to think most of us recognize that good communication in itself is hard , but I do think a lot...
Are there any real alternatives to agile development in commercial software? There’s waterfall development, which overemphasizes software design in trading off the speed of iteration. It may be appropriate in specific, limited domains where...